Agua Posted September 5, 2002 Share Posted September 5, 2002 Uh ... yeah, that would be the side with the grey uni's in the woods on the hill by the flag, right? Seriously, the a/i led with the tanks, and due to command delay, my ATG was able to take on one tank at a time. Neither tank was knocked out, they just bailed. The ATG then went to work with its HE. One of the infantry squads did run low on ammo, so I just ordered a counter clockwise rotation of that squad units on that side and brought up the other squad with nearly a full ammo load. TSword Posted September 5, 2002 Share Posted September 5, 2002 I think the Tutorial can only be won without extra troops if one is lucky with the ATG in killing both Tanks early. SPOILER WARNING With a gun and a Squad and 1 HQ one can get the Russians panicked using arcs on the open between two forests. Posting the other Squad together with a HQ in ambush near the entry point into wood with flag kills eventual intruders. But key is to neutralize tanks early.
